### Alert: Session-Token Refresh Failures

The Larkspur identity service is intermittently failing to refresh session tokens, causing some users to be logged out of the Pondside dashboard roughly every fifteen minutes. The failure occurs when a refresh request races with an expiring token; affected users see a generic sign-in prompt rather than an error. A fix is in validation. Advise users to sign in again as a temporary workaround. For ticket escalation or status questions, contact the identity on-call at the address below.

alerts address for kajog-tadup: druox@plorvanet.internal

Runbook: ConsentCrate banner rollout (Phase 2)

Before approving the deploy, confirm the banner variant flags match the regional matrix in the rollout sheet, and that BANNER_REGION_SET lists only the Tallowmere pilot markets. Then verify the env file is complete: the signing credential used by the consent logger appears on the very next line.

secret setting of baduf-fahag: LEDGER_TOKEN8=35e35511

All — quick status for the weekly sync on the Fenwick transcoding farm. We cut re-encode latency 18% by pinning the Harlbrook nodes to the new preset cache, and the 4K queue no longer starves shorter jobs. One regression: audio-only jobs briefly double-billed worker slots; fix is merged and rolling out. Capacity review moves to Thursday. Please hold any farm config changes until rollout completes. The rollout candidate everyone should validate against is the one listed below.

pipeline stamp: htk9_ce63042d9